Notes
The Gramophone issues are from the Victor blue history card and not confirmed. Alan Kelly files list instead 100-2460 and HN-56.
The unconfirmed take place is based on the location stated on Victor disc labels of other recordings by Gilda Mignonette made in August 1933, but it is possible the location was Naples.
Source(s): Alan Kelly files (take date); Victor blue history card.
